1. 系统使用拼音搜索,表里面加入三个字段即可
即 拼音字段 pinyin 首字母字段 first_word 简写字段 short_cut
如下表:
id | city | pinyin | first_word | short_cut |
1 | 北京 | beijing | b | bj |
2 | 杭州 | hangzhou | h | hz |
3 | 广州 | guangzhou | g | gz |
4 | 上海 | shanghai | s | sh |
这样不管是搜索全拼还是 输入简拼 或者首字母 均可使用 like 完成
2. 有些旧表并未维护拼音,可以把常见的字存入字表
可将常见字存入常用字拼音表,常见字可参考。
3. 使用第三方库
拼音库: https://github.com/overtrue/pinyin